In addition to the personal benefits that coaches receive, USA Hockey InLine provides many other benefits and resource materials for amateur inline hockey coaches. Once a coach registers with USA Hockey InLine, the benefits of membership begin immediately and continue for the entire registration/ playing season (June 1 - May 31). Below are some of the many benefits that are provided by USA Hockey InLine for all registered coaches: - Liability, catastrophic and excess medical insurance coverage
- One season subscription to American Hockey Magazine mailed directly to the coaches home (10 times per year)
- USA Hockey InLine coaches manuals (2) mailed directly to the coaches home (newly registered coaches only)
- USA Hockey InLine coach's membership card mailed directly to the coach's home
- USA Hockey InLine Official Playing Rules of Inline Hockey obtained through the sanctioned League Director
- Opportunities to attend instructional seminars and clinics conducted by trained clinic instructors
- Game Time (Coaches and Officials Newsletter) mailed directly to the coaches home (4 times per year)
- Possible involvement in the USA Hockey InLine National Player Skill Development program
- Other printed materials to assist in the development of team and individual skills
- The opportunity to continue improving their coaching education level with a future level 2 coaching program soon to be in place.
